IMG to develop licensing portfolio for Jim Beam brands as the iconic bourbon celebrates 225 years

Published on: 24th June 2020

IMG has signed with Beam Suntory to help extend the James B. Beam Distilling Company’s portfolio of brands through a raft of new strategic licensing partnerships.

The company is widely known for its Jim Beam Bourbon, a global brand of bourbon that is celebrating its 225th anniversary this year. The James B. Beam Distilling Company’s American Whiskey portfolio also includes Knob Creek, Basil Hayden’s, Booker’s, Baker’s, Legent and Little Book.

Under the partnership, IMG will be tasked with developing products that celebrate the company’s rich history, its good-natured and convivial style and its bold flavor profile. Targeted categories will include experiential, fashion, home, gift, memorabilia, grilling and bourbon-flavored foods.

Tom Bufalino, director at James B. Beam Distilling Company, said: “As we celebrate our 225th year, this is the perfect time to extend our iconic brands to products and experiences that create new platforms and occasions to welcome consumers, old and new, to our product and personality. With its deep experience and resources, there is no better partner than IMG to accompany us on that journey.”

Bruno Maglione, president of licensing at IMG, added: “It’s an honour for us to join the First Family of bourbon. This is a beloved quintessentially American brand and a time-venerated quality product that is all about family values, shared experiences and accessibility. Through the Jim Beam licensing program, we will develop products that place an accent on each of those attributes.”

IMG will develop strategies and pursue licensing opportunities for many of the other distinctive brands in the James B. Beam Distilling Company’s portfolio including Knob Creek, Basil Hayden’s, Booker’s, Legent and Little Book.
